Beloved Quote by Gordon B. Hinckley
“Thank and glorify His Beloved Son, who, with indescribable suffering, gave His life on Calvary's cross to pay the debt of mortal sin. He it was who, through His atoning sacrifice, broke the bonds of death and with godly power rose triumphant from the tomb. He is our Redeemer, the Redeemer of all mankind. He is the Savior of the world. He is the Son of God, the Author of our salvation.”
About This Quote
Source Speech: General Conference, The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ter‑Day Saints, 1995
